US GOV OFFERS A REWARD OF UP TO $15M FOR INFO ON LOCKBIT GANG MEMBERS AND AFFILIATES

Security Affairs

According to the press release published by the Department of State , the Lockbit ransomware operators carried out over 2,000 attacks against victims worldwide since January 2020. The NCA and its global partners have secured over 1,000 decryption keys that will allow victims of the gang to recover their files for free.

Researchers shared the lists of victims of SolarWinds hack

Security Affairs

Security experts shared lists of organizations that were infected with the SolarWinds Sunburst backdoor after decoding the DGA mechanism. Security experts started analyzing the DGA mechanism used by threat actors behind the SolarWinds hack to control the Sunburst / Solarigate backdoor and published the list of targeted organizations.

Best Distributed Denial of Service (DDoS) Protection Tools

eSecurity Planet

Distributed denial of service (DDoS) attacks can cripple an organization, a network, or even an entire country, and they show no sign of slowing down. DDoS attacks may only make up a small percentage of security threats, but their consequences can be devastating. According to Imperva Research Labs, DDoS attacks tend to come in waves.
